What's Different About Prime Day 2026
This year's Prime Day runs four full days — June 23 through June 26 — instead of the two-day window Amazon used for years. It also moves up from its traditional July timing to late June. The earlier date means less competition from back-to-school sales at rival retailers, and Amazon is leaning into that, using Prime Day to push exclusive colorways and home goods alongside its usual electronics focus.
Early deals started rolling out in the first week of June, with some already discounted deeply enough to justify buying now rather than waiting.

How to Shop Without Overspending
Not every Prime Day "deal" is a genuine discount. Retailers sometimes inflate list prices before a sale event. To protect yourself:
- Build a wish list now. Add the exact models you want on Amazon today so you can track price movement.
- Use CamelCamelCamel. This free tool shows the full price history of any Amazon listing. If an item is at its six-month low, the deal is real.
- Check early each morning. Lightning deals on kitchen items often go live at midnight Pacific / 3 a.m. Eastern. A morning check before work catches most of them.
- Watch the final hours of June 26. Cancelled orders release back into inventory. Some deals also extend slightly past the official cutoff.
Amazon retail analyst coverage notes that early deals are already competitive enough that waiting is a small risk — popular items, especially bundle sets, can sell out before June 23 even begins.
